 Irish traditional music session -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Sessions are often held in pubs (with the hope that listeners will buy drinks for the musicians) and everyone who is able to play Irish music on an instrument is welcomed; 'grab your instrument and join along'.
The objective in a session is not to provide music for an audience of passive listeners, but in pub sessions, the punters (non-playing attendees) often come for the express purpose of listening, and the music is for the musicians themselves.
The sessions are a key aspect of traditional music; some say it is the main sphere in which the music is formulated and innovated.

 The Irish Session (part 1)
After talking to some native Irish, and some library and internet research, I understand that the traditional Irish pub session is a recent phenomenon, which became popular only after the folk craze of the 1960s, and may have had its origin earlier among Irish immigrants in America, not Ireland.
The pub session is perhaps the last remaining venue for amateur musicians to get together and play their music.
In 1978 virtually no instrumental music was heard in the pubs, although sometimes someone would get out his fiddle, or maybe there would be a fiddle and an accordion, but this was generally at Mrs.
